.gdbファイルはファイルGeodatabaseファイルです。これは、ディスク上のフォルダー内のファイルのコレクションで、空間データと非空間データの両方を保存、クエリ、および管理できます。これは、ARCGISソフトウェアで使用するためにESRIによって開発された独自のファイル形式です。
.gdbファイルには、次の種類のデータを含めることができます。
- 機能クラス:機能クラスは、共通の属性セットを共有する機能のコレクションです。特徴は、ポイント、ライン、ポリゴン、またはラスターです。
- 機能データセット:機能データセットは、互いに関連する機能クラスのコレクションです。
- 表:テーブルは、データの行と列のコレクションです。テーブルを使用して、機能クラスの属性データなど、非空間データを保存できます。
- ラスターデータセット:ラスターデータセットは、ラスター画像のコレクションです。
- 概略データセット:回路図データセットは、 .gdbファイルの機能とテーブルの関係を表す図のコレクションです。
.gdbファイルは、次のようなさまざまなソフトウェアアプリケーションで開くことができます。
.gdbファイルを作成するには、次の手順を使用できます。
- ArcGISデスクトップまたはArcGis Proを開きます。
- カタログペインで、データベースまたはフォルダーの下のフォルダーを右クリックして、新しいファイルGeodatabaseをクリックします。
- [新しいファイルGeodatabase]ダイアログボックスで、 .gdbファイルを作成する場所を参照し、名前を入力し、[保存]をクリックします。
.gdbファイルを作成したら、データツールを追加してデータを追加できます。 ArcGISインターフェイスを使用して、 .gdbファイルのデータをクエリおよび管理することもできます。
.gdbファイルを別の形式に変換する方法は?
.gdbファイルを別の形式に変換する方法はいくつかあります。 1つの方法は、ArcGISデスクトップまたはArcGIS Proで変換ジオダタベースツールを使用することです。このツールは、 .gdbファイルを指定した形式に変換します。
.gdbファイルを別の形式に変換する別の方法は、サードパーティのソフトウェアアプリケーションを使用することです。 .gdbファイルを次のようなさまざまな形式に変換できるソフトウェアアプリケーションが多数あります。
- 地理空間データ抽象化ライブラリ(GDAL):https://gdal.org/
- ogr2ogr:https://gdal.org/programs/ogr2ogr.html
- QGIS:https://qgis.org/en/site/
サードパーティソフトウェアアプリケーションを使用して.gdbファイルを変換するには、ソフトウェアアプリケーションを開き、変換する.gdbファイルを選択する必要があります。次に、 .gdbファイルを変換する形式を指定する必要があります。ソフトウェアアプリケーションは、 .gdbファイルを指定された形式に変換します。
.gdbファイルを変換するための追加のヒントを次に示します。
- 変換する前に、 .gdbファイルのバックアップコピーがあることを確認してください。このようにして、変換が失敗した場合でも、元の.gdbファイルを復元できます。
- .gdbファイルを変換するために使用しているソフトウェアアプリケーションとターゲット形式の互換性を確認します。すべてのソフトウェアアプリケーションがすべての形式をサポートするわけではありません。
- サードパーティのソフトウェアアプリケーションを使用して.gdbファイルを変換している場合は、ソフトウェアアプリケーションが最新であることを確認してください。ソフトウェアアプリケーションの古いバージョンは、最新の.GDBファイル形式をサポートしない場合があります。
破損した.gdbファイルを修復する方法は?
破損した.gdbファイルを修復する方法はいくつかあります。 1つの方法は、ArcGISデスクトップまたはArcGIS Proで修理ジオダタベースツールを使用することです。このツールは、 .gdbファイルで見つかった破損を修正しようとします。
破損した.GDBファイルを修復する別の方法は、 GDBFIXコマンドラインツールを使用することです。このツールは、GDALソフトウェアパッケージの一部です。 GDBFIXを使用するには、コマンドプロンプトを開き、GDBFIX実行可能ファイルが配置されているフォルダーに移動する必要があります。次に、次のコマンドを使用して、 .gdbファイルを修復できます。
gdbfix -r corrupt.gdb
-rオプションは、GDBFIXに.gdbファイルを修復するように指示します。修理が成功した場合、gdbfixは「corood.gdb.bak」と呼ばれる新しい.gdbファイルを作成します。このファイルには、元の.gdbファイルから修復されたデータが含まれます。
Repair GeodatabaseツールまたはGDBFIXが.GDBファイルを修復できない場合は、支援のためにESRIサポートに連絡する必要がある場合があります。
腐敗した.gdbファイルを修復するための追加のヒントを次に示します。
- 修理しようとする前に、 .gdbファイルのバックアップコピーがあることを確認してください。これにより、修理が失敗した場合でも、元の.gdbファイルを復元できます。
- .gdbファイルを修復しようとする前に、腐敗の原因を特定してみてください。この情報は、適切な修理ツールまたは方法を選択するのに役立ちます。
- ArcGISデスクトップまたはArcGIS Proで修理ジオダタベースツールを使用している場合は、すべての腐敗オプションを修復することを確認してください。このオプションは、 .gdbファイルで見つかったすべての破損を修正しようとします。
- GDBFIXコマンドラインツールを使用している場合は、-Vオプションを使用して、より多くの冗長出力を取得できます。この出力は、修理プロセスのトラブルシューティングに役立ちます。
.gdbファイルの制限は何ですか?
- サイズ制限: .gdbファイルの最大サイズは16TBです。この制限は、大規模なデータセットの問題になる可能性があります。
- プラットフォーム互換性: .gdbファイルは、 Windows、MacOS、およびLinuxオペレーティングシステムとのみ互換性があります。この制限は、 .GDBファイルを他のプラットフォームでユーザーと共有する必要があるユーザーにとって問題になる可能性があります。
- 機能タイプの制限: .gdbファイルは、ポイント、ライン、ポリゴン、ラスターデータのみを保存できます。この制限は、3Dデータや時系列データなど、他のタイプのデータを保存する必要があるユーザーにとって問題になる可能性があります。
- セキュリティの制限: .gdbファイルには、組み込みのセキュリティ機能がありません。これは、 .gdbファイルにアクセスできる人なら誰でもデータを表示および変更できることを意味します。
.gdbファイルの利点は何ですか?
- スケーラビリティ: .gdbファイルは非常に大きなサイズにスケーリングでき、大きなデータセットを保存するのに適した選択肢になります。
- パフォーマンス: .gdbファイルは、一般に、ShapeFilesなどの空間データの他のファイル形式よりも高速です。
- 柔軟性: .GDBファイルは、ポイント、ライン、ポリゴン、ラスターなど、さまざまな空間データ型を保存できます。
- 相互運用性: .GDBファイルは、 ArcGISデスクトップ、ArcGIS Pro、QGISなど、さまざまなソフトウェアアプリケーションによってサポートされています。
- セキュリティ: .GDBファイルはパスワードで保護でき、機密データを保存するのに適した選択肢になります。